Approaches that guide online sessions



Kelli draws on cognitive behavioral therapy to help clients identify unhelpful thoughts and develop practical skills for changing behaviors and emotional responses; this approach is often used for depression, problem-solving, and adjusting to life changes. She also uses a client-centered model that prioritizes empathic listening and the client’s own goals, creating space for individuals to explore values and strengths at their own pace.

Choosing the right approach is a collaborative process. Kelli works with clients to determine which methods best match their needs and preferences and adjusts direction as progress and goals evolve, inviting feedback and shared decision-making throughout therapy.
